What Are Chemicals Used For?
Chemicals are a basic material in ARC Raiders that can be used for crafting several items, including medical supplies, explosives, and utility items. As a common resource, it’s easy to find and often required in bulk for various recipes. Here’s a brief list of items you can craft using Chemicals:
Adrenaline Shot – Boosts your health in tight situations.
Antiseptic – Heals wounds and prevents infections.
Crude Explosives – Used to craft more advanced explosive items.
Firecracker – A low-level explosive that can distract or damage enemies.
Gas Grenades – A tactical grenade that releases harmful gas to incapacitate enemies.
While these are just a few examples, Chemicals are involved in a wide array of crafting recipes that cover both offense and defense, as well as survival needs.
How Do You Obtain Chemicals?
There are a few ways to get your hands on Chemicals in ARC Raiders. Here are the main sources:
Scavenging: Chemicals can be found while scavenging around the environment. Look for containers, crates, or other sources of materials.
Recycling: You can recycle other items into Chemicals, which is a good way to repurpose old gear and get more use out of it.
Celeste: The NPC vendor Celeste sells Chemicals for a certain price, allowing you to buy them directly if you're short on stock.
Scrappy: Scrappy, another vendor, may have Chemicals available for sale, often in bundles.
When you're starting out, scavenging is probably your best bet to build up a supply of Chemicals. Recycling items you no longer need can also be an efficient way to gather them.
What Can You Craft with Chemicals?
Chemicals are central to crafting in ARC Raiders. Below are some of the most useful recipes you can craft using this material:
1. Adrenaline Shot
Ingredients: 3 Chemicals + 3 Plastic Parts
Crafting Station: Medical Lab (or In-Round Crafting)
Purpose: Instantly restores health, making it a valuable item for survival.
2. Antiseptic
Ingredients: 10 Chemicals + 2 Great Mullein
Crafting Station: Refiner 2
Purpose: Heals and cleans wounds, preventing infection. Essential for long-term survival in the game.
3. Crude Explosives
Ingredients: 6 Chemicals
Crafting Station: Refiner 1
Purpose: A basic explosive used in crafting other explosive items.
4. Firecracker
Ingredients: 4 Chemicals + 2 Plastic Parts
Crafting Station: Utility Station 1
Purpose: A small explosive for causing distractions or dealing light damage to enemies.
5. Gas Grenade
Ingredients: 4 Chemicals + 2 Rubber Parts
Crafting Station: Explosives Station 1
Purpose: A grenade that releases a damaging gas cloud, useful for crowd control and enemy disorientation.
These are just a handful of the many recipes that require Chemicals. If you're serious about crafting in ARC Raiders, you'll want to stockpile as many Chemicals as possible to ensure you're always ready to craft the right items for the situation.

How Do Chemicals Factor Into the Upgrade System?
In ARC Raiders, you'll often need to upgrade your workstations to craft more advanced items. Chemicals play a crucial role in these upgrades.
For instance, to upgrade to Explosives Station 1, you'll need 50 Chemicals and 6 ARC Alloy. These upgrades not only expand your crafting capabilities but also enable you to access more powerful equipment.
If you're focused on explosive items or utility items, make sure to plan ahead and stock up on Chemicals. You don't want to be caught in a situation where you're unable to craft the gear you need because you're out of this basic material.
Recycling Chemicals: What Can You Get?
Recycling is another key feature in ARC Raiders. By recycling certain items, you can get back some of the materials you used to craft them, including Chemicals. Here are some items that can be recycled into Chemicals:
Adrenaline Shots – Recycled into 1 Chemical
Antiseptic – Recycled into 10 Chemicals
Crude Explosives – Recycled into 3 Chemicals
Gas Grenade – Recycled into 1 Chemical
Smoke Grenade – Recycled into 14 Chemicals
Recycling is a great way to recover some of the resources you spent on other items and keep your Chemical stock topped off. If you're crafting a lot, keep an eye on what you can recycle.
Is There a Max Stack for Chemicals?
Yes, Chemicals have a stack size of 50, meaning you can carry up to 50 at once in a single stack. Once you hit that limit, you'll need to use or drop some before you can gather more. This can be particularly important when you're scavenging or in the middle of a crafting session.
